设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

123下一页
返回列表 发新帖
查看: 8394|回复: 23

[表] 如何实现一键数据导入ACCESS

[复制链接]
发表于 2011-4-2 06:56:34 | 显示全部楼层 |阅读模式
本帖最后由 wangxy689 于 2011-7-2 22:57 编辑

我制作了个切换面板,上面要设置了个”数据导入“按钮,就是想将EXCEL中的数据导入到ACCESS中。要让这个按钮实现以下功能:
1、选择路径找到文件,并导入到access中,并命名“测试数据”;
2、将导入access表中的数据中的”预估金额“自动转换为数字格式
要求:如果能用宏实现最好;如果不能,请用VBA代码来实现。期盼!!!!
发表于 2011-4-2 09:18:27 | 显示全部楼层
回复 wangxy689 的帖子

你试试看有用吗?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
发表于 2011-4-2 11:02:24 | 显示全部楼层
本帖最后由 roych 于 2011-4-2 11:06 编辑

回复 wangxy689 的帖子

1、如果自定义路径的话,应该引用office库之后用filedialog对象来处理。
2、转换格式时可以用转换函数来处理。不过个人认为,最佳方式是在表中设置好字段类型(请留意附件的Order字段类型和Excel文件中的Order单元格格式)。不得已时也可以这样考虑,先导入到临时表,再用转换函数追加到主表。
本应是你而不是我传上附件的……

附件的使用:把内置的excel文件放在任意地方,然后打开access文件,点击“导入数据”按钮来浏览打开即可。如果无法运行,则可能因为office库的缘故,请到VBE界面点击工具\引用重新引用office库(我的是11.0版本的),如下所示:


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
 楼主| 发表于 2011-4-2 20:20:11 | 显示全部楼层
谢谢楼上的两位老师,感谢了。
 楼主| 发表于 2011-4-2 20:21:23 | 显示全部楼层
回复 roych 的帖子

谢谢老师,在你的帮助下,学习ACCEESS的路上我不再孤单了,谢谢您老师。
发表于 2011-4-3 22:36:59 | 显示全部楼层
数据导入一向是个比较让人挠头的问题,尤其是初期数据导入的时候,因为数据经常不符合规范,出状况比较多
发表于 2011-4-4 10:35:04 | 显示全部楼层
回复 wangxy689 的帖子

我可不是老师!!我只是拿别人的实例举一反三而已!!
发表于 2011-4-12 10:16:34 | 显示全部楼层
学习。
发表于 2011-4-12 15:21:01 | 显示全部楼层
这个帮了我大忙了。谢谢。
发表于 2011-4-12 22:04:50 | 显示全部楼层
跟美女再学习一次.
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-4-19 08:46 , Processed in 0.106457 second(s), 35 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表